WebDeforestation in Thailand refers to the conversion of its forested land to other uses.Deforestation numbers are inexact due to the scope of the issue. According to the Royal Forest Department (RFD) in 2024, Thai forests cover 31.6% (102 million rai) of Thailand's landmass. The department claims that forest coverage grew by 330,000 rai in …
